Maybelline Fit Me Foundation & Concealer




Maybelline is a great drugstore brand - it's affordable, it has a huge range of products and has been around for years! For me personally, the Fit Me range is my favourite - I love the foundation and concealer. 
The foundation retails for £9.99 which is the standard drugstore price for a foundation. It has a smooth texture - it feels lovely and moisturising on the skin and makes the skin look healthy and dewy and it also has an SPF of 18. As the texture is smooth, it is very easy to blend and it doesn't appear cakey or anything like that. I picked up the shade 220 Natural Beige as I like to wear this foundation with tan and it matches my tan very well, though there are 18 shades altogether in the collection so choosing a shade to match you would be fairly easy.
The concealer retails for £5.99 which is also a very good price. It has quite a light and smooth texture which makes it very easy to blend and smooth over any fine lines around the eye area - and it also helps to brighten the under eye are as well. It does have good coverage so I also like to use this on blemishes.

Revlon Photoready Prime + Antishine



I love Revlons Photoready section, I think for the price, the quality and results are amazing! And this product is no different, any time I have used it, I'm matte and stay matte, it keeps my make-up on for a good few hours before I would need to touch up, if even and in pictures I look flawless. 
But what i also love about this is that you can use this as a primer and also to matte your skin before you apply your make-up, but you can also apply it after your makeup is done, if you happen to think you look a bit shiny you can just apply it like you would with a powder and it doesn't disturb your makeup in the slightest! 

Overall, a really great product which I would highly recommend!

Barry M Chisel Cheeks Contour Kit


I'm a little on the fence about this product, there are things that I like and things that I don't. I like the packaging, I think it's really cute, it's not too bulky and it's a good size to take with you if you were going travelling. I like the colour and the tones of the products, they're quite cool toned which I like and there's a very gradual shade difference, it's not to harsh between the bronze shade and the contour shade which makes for a really natural contour. They also blend really nice and look very natural.

What I don't like, is the smell. When I first bought it I thought i was maybe just the packaging or the wee bit of plastic that protects the powders - but now I think it is the actual product which is pretty off putting for me as it doesn't smell the best, though you can't smell if when it's on your face so I guess it's not too bad and when I bought it was on offer for about £5.99 I think, so I can't really complain.

NARS Sheer Glow Foundation


Here I am wearing my NARS Sheer Glow Foundation and my skin just looks wonderful and healthy with a lovely glow. On my lips I have Bourjois Rouge Edition Velvet in Don't Pink of It (10) which is a gorgeous muted matte pink shade

I have wanted this foundation for ages and unfortunately no where in Northern Ireland sells it and to be honest, I didn't want to buy it online in case it came broke or something, so I decided to wait until I went to Birmingham to get it. 
I got the shade Punjab which is Medium 1 and it was £31...... pretty expensive I know, but that's around the standard price for a high end foundation and it was totally worth it.

The coverage is really nice, I would say it would medium to definitely buildable, it gives the skin a really nice luminosity/dewy glow making the skin look lovely and healthy. It blends really nice into the skin as well and doesn't appear cakey even when I build it to full coverage.
Overall, this foundation is everything I wanted it to be and I will definitely be purchasing it again, maybe even online! :)
